ARTICLE 64 POPULATION AND DEVELOPMENT 1. Member States undertake to adopt, individually and collectively, national population policiesand mechanisms and take all necessary measures in order to ensure a balance between demographicfactorsand socio-economic development. 2. To this end, Member States agree to: a) include population issues as central components in formulating and implementing national policies and programmes for accelerated and balanced socio-economic development; b) formulate national population policies and establish national population institutions; c) undertake public sensitisation on population matters, particularly among the target groups; and d) collect, analyse andexchange information anddataon population issues. ARTICLE 65 INFORMATION, RADIO AND TELEVISION Member States undertake to: a) co-ordinate theirefforts andpooltheirresources in orderto promote theexchange of radio and television programmes at bilateraland regional levels; b) encourage the establishment of programme exchange centres at regional level and strengthen existing programme exchange centres; c) use their broadcasting and television systems to promote the attainment of the objectives of the Community. 39
